What is Cirrus Logic's rest of world — net sales?
Cirrus Logic (CRUS) reported rest of world — net sales of $227.79M in Q1 2026.
How has Cirrus Logic's rest of world — net sales changed year-over-year?
Cirrus Logic's rest of world — net sales increased by 13.6% year-over-year, from $200.48M to $227.79M.
What is the long-term trend for Cirrus Logic's rest of world — net sales?
Over 3 years (2023 to 2026), Cirrus Logic's rest of world — net sales has grown at a 14.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$614.33M to $915.64M.
What does rest of world — net sales mean?
This metric represents the total revenue generated from product sales and services within geographic regions outside of the company's primary domestic or major reporting markets. It reflects the company's ability to capture market share and monetize its technology portfolio in international territories. Monitoring this figure helps assess the geographic diversification of the revenue stream and the effectiveness of global sales strategies.
